Sense Appoints Duke Energy Executive Meghan Dewey to Board of Directors
Senior utility leader brings deep expertise in customer strategy, innovation, regulatory policy and grid modernization
CAMBRIDGE, Mass., July 1, 2026 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 — Sense, a grid-edge intelligence company partnering with electric utilities to build a more reliable, resilient, and affordable electric system, today announced the appointment of Meghan Dewey to its Board of Directors.
Dewey serves as Senior Vice President of Products, Services and Pricing Solutions at Duke Energy, where she leads customer-focused programs and strategies designed to enhance value and experience across the company’s service territories. She also oversees customer pricing, rate design, products and services regulatory strategy, and the development of long-term grid solutions through Duke Energy’s Emerging Technology Office.

Dewey joined Duke Energy in 2023 after more than a decade at Pacific Gas and Electric Company (PG&E), where she held leadership roles spanning customer care, utility partnerships, innovation, customer strategy, and regulatory policy. Prior to PG&E, Dewey worked for several consulting firms leading business and program development initiatives focused on sustainable energy solutions for government, utility, and commercial clients nationwide.
Dewey holds a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of North Carolina Wilmington and a Master’s degree from Portland State University.
About Sense
Sense is making the energy transition accessible to everyone. Sense’s embedded intelligence redefines how utilities and consumers interact with homes and the grid. By partnering with meter manufacturers, Sense delivers software driven by high-resolution data that’s vital for utilities to better engage with customers, detect devices, balance load, forecast demand and identify anomalies.
